Alternative Site Testing CAUTION - Test results may vary if blood samples are taken from different sites or under certain conditions when glucose levels are changing rapidly such as: following a drink, a meal, an insulin dose or exercise. In these cases, only the fingertip should be used. - DO NOT test on the palm or forearm if you are testing for hypoglycemia (Low blood glucose). - Fingertip samples can show rapid changes in glucose faster than palm or forearm samples.
Understanding Test Results and Messages Understanding Test Results and Messages Blood glucose test results are shown on the GE100 Blood Glucose Meter as mg/dL. The GE100 Blood Glucose Meter displays results between 20 and 600 mg/dL. If your blood glucose result is unusually high or low, or if you question your test results, repeat the test with a new GE100 Blood Glucose Test Strip.

Recalling Test Results and Average Recalling Test Results and Average The GE100 Blood Glucose Meter is able to automatically store a maximum of 500 test results with time and date. If your meter has stored 500 results, the newest test result will replace the oldest one. To recall your test memory, start the meter without a test strip inserted. 1. Press the Main button to switch from the time mode to the Memory screen. You will see the ”MEM” symbol in the upper left corner of the display.

Specifications Limitations - Store the GE100 Blood Glucose Test Strips in the original capped vial at temperatures between 39°F to 86°F ( 4°C to 30°C ) and relative humidity below 90%. Do not freeze. - GE100 Blood Glucose Test Strips are designed for using with capillary whole blood samples. Do not use serum or plasma samples. - Inaccurate test results may be obtained at altitudes greater than 10,000 feet (30048 meters) above sea level.
